Renting out rooms
MORE homeowners than ever are tackling the problem of increased mortgage costs by renting out rooms in their property to lodgers.
According to SpareRoom.co.uk, the number of homeowners looking to lodgers to bridge a shortfall in funds, by renting out a room, has doubled in the past 18 months.
The number of live-in landlords on the website has risen from 400,000 to 700,000.
SpareRoom spokesperson Matt Hutchinson believes it is a great way of generating extra cash.
"It can be the perfect short-term solution while you wait and see what the housing market does over the next year."
SpareRoom have devised an information website to deal with the influx of questions on the subject.
